This medical gatekeeping created a unique subculture within LGBTQ spaces: the "stealth" culture. Many trans people, once they transitioned, disappeared into the heterosexual mainstream, severing ties with LGBTQ communities to avoid detection. This era bred both safety and isolation. It also meant that the visible, proud transgender subculture we see today—with its own slang, fashion, and social media influencers—was nearly non-existent. Instead, trans existence was a secret whispered in the back rooms of gay bars and support groups.

Statistically, transgender individuals experience disproportionately higher rates of unemployment, homelessness, and mental health struggles compared to their cisgender peers. These vulnerabilities are compounded by intersectionality. Transgender people of color, particularly Black trans women, face a dual burden of racism and transphobia, resulting in alarmingly high rates of fatal violence and discrimination.
